Shepherd Men Top Indiana (Pa.)

SHEPHERDSTOWN, W.Va. – Sophomore guard Marcus Banks (Clinton, Md./Riverdale Baptist) scored a game-high 18 points to lead Shepherd University (5-3, 3-0 PSAC) to a 68-57 win over Indiana (Pa.) (5-4, 2-1 PSAC) in PSAC men's basketball action at the Butcher Center on Friday.

Banks connected on 6-of-10 field goals with a 1-of-2 effort from beyond the arc. He added five rebounds, two assists, and two steals.

Sophomore forward Cole Paar (Mount Airy, Md./Glenelg Country School/Towson) added 10 points, while sophomore guard Michael Cooper (Woodbridge, Va./Woodbridge) tossed in nine. Graduate student forward Chase Paar (Mount Airy, Md./Glenelg Country School/Towson) was a point shy of a double-double with nine points and 10 rebounds.

Kymani Merraro had 17 points to lead IUP. Damir Brooks added a double-double with 12 points and 11 rebounds.

Shepherd had a 38-27 lead at halftime.

Shepherd built an 18-point lead in the second half after Cole Paar hit a jumper to give the Rams a 52-34 advantage with 13:34 left.

IUP used a 15-0 run to rally to within three points at 52-49 after a free throw by Christian Moore with 7:16 remaining but would get no closer.

Shepherd connected on 50 percent (23-46) of its field goals with a 38.1 percent (8-21) performance from three-point range. The Rams drained 77.8 percent (14-18) of their free throws.

Indiana (Pa.) shot 36.8 percent (21-57) from the floor with a 23.5 percent (4-17) effort from beyond the arc. The Crimson Hawks hit 84.6 percent (11-13) from the foul line.

Each team had 31 rebounds. The Rams forced 10 turnovers and committed 12.

The Rams return to action on Saturday when they host Clarion for a 3 p.m. contest.
